Identification title(s): view of the entrance to the sint-pietersberg and view of the sint-pietersberg, near maastrichtthe entrance to the st. Pieters berg by maastricht / st. Pieters berg by maastricht 1740 (title on object). Object type: picture book illustration object number: rp-p-ao-16-60-1. Description: above a view of the entrance to the sint-pietersberg near maastricht. Below a view of the sint-pietersberg near maastricht, in the situation around 1740. Manufacture. Manufacturer: printmaker: hendrik spilman (mentioned on object) after a drawing by: jan de beijer (mentioned on object). Place of manufacture: haarlem. Dating: 1746 - 1792. Material: paper technique: etching / engraving (printing process). Dimensions: plate edge: h 167 mm × w 112 mm. Explanation: print also used in: het verheerlykt nederland or cabinet of contemporary views of cities, villages (. . . ). 9 parts. Amsterdam: isaak tirion and widow isaak tirion, 1745-1774, vol. 2 (1746), ill. 137-138. Or in: dutch scenes; or a neat collection of nine hundred beautiful views of cities, villages, ditches, antiquities (. . ) 9 parts. Amsterdam: jan de groot, 1792, vol. 2, ill. 137-138. Subject: what: cave, grotto. Where: sint-pietersbergmaastricht. Acquisition: transfer of management 1887. Date: between 1746 and 1792.
